O Neal has 6 Finals, with 36 points and 15 rebounds per game in three consecutive championships. So what are the performances of the other 3 times?
As we all know, the Shark O'Neal is one of the most dominant players, especially at his peak, who is almost unstoppable at the basket. He is 2.16 meters tall and weighs nearly 300 kilograms. He is also very athletic. He has basically no solution to one-on-one at the basket. So in the early 21st century, he led the Lakers to a dynasty moment of three consecutive championships. During the three consecutive championships, O'Neal averaged an exaggerated data of 36 points and 15 rebounds per game. Do you know how many times he averaged in the finals? The difference is really big. 00 was O'Neal's peak moment. At that time, he was the league's regular season MVP and the scoring champion. He was the sharpest existence on both offense and defense. He led the Lakers to make great strides in the playoffs, and finally overturned the Pacers in 6 games in the finals. He averaged 38 points and 16.7 rebounds per game. No matter who faced O'Neal, he was beaten, and the Sharks also successfully won the championship. A year later, the Lakers made a comeback, and this finals opponent was stronger because the Sharks had to face Mutombo. After all, Uncle Mu is a DPOY-level defender, but he still can't limit O'Neal. The Sharks scored another average of 33 points and 15.8 rebounds in the finals, easily leading the team to win the championship again. In 2002, O'Neal successfully led the Lakers to three consecutive championships, and swept the Nets 4-0 in the finals. O'Neal averaged 36.3 points and 12.3 rebounds per game. In the finals of 3 consecutive championships, O'Neal averaged 36 points and 15 rebounds per game, and he deservedly won the FMVP crown for three consecutive years. Look at the other 3 finals trips. The first runner-up was in the Magic period. In 1995, the Magic team entered the finals and finally lost to the Great Dream Olajuwon. The young O'Neal performed very well, and the score of 28 points, 12.5 rebounds and 6.3 assists per game in the finals is considered comprehensive. However, the peak dream is integrated with offense and defense, and ultimately suppressing O'Neal to win the championship. The second runner-up was in 2004. The OK combination was in the top spot, and Kobe was also very strong. The Lakers once again entered the finals stage. Facing the Pistons' Five Tigers, O'Neal actually performed well. He contributed steadily averaging 26.6 points, 10.8 rebounds and 1.6 assists per game, and maintained a 63% shooting percentage. However, Kobe was completely lost that year, and the Lakers were also beaten up. The last finals was in 2006. O'Neal was already 34 years old and he had already experienced a significant decline. Wade was the team's leader. The Sharks didn't have much advantage in shooting this time. In the finals, they only scored a double-double of 13.7 points and 10.2 rebounds per game, and they were completely blue-collar.
